Background
After the base is treated by solvent refining, solvent dewaxing and deasphalting, the oil product also contains macromolecular condensate, colloid, etc. produced by heating recovered solvent. The presence of these impurities affects the stability, color, carbon residue value, etc. of the oil. Therefore, the base oil is generally refined by using the argil before use, and the purpose is to utilize the selective adsorption characteristic of the argil, so that after the argil is fully mixed and contacted with an oil product, colloid, asphaltene, residual solvent and other impurities in the argil are easily adsorbed, and the oil adsorption capacity is weaker, thereby reducing the carbon residue value and acid value (or acidity) of the oil product, improving the color and stability of the oil product, and achieving the purpose of refining the oil product. The base oil need filter the base oil after the carclazyte is exquisite, separates out carclazyte wherein, and traditional filter equipment is when clearing up the filter residue, because filter residue and base oil can not by effectual separation, the filter residue in-process of clearance can waste partial base oil, and current filter equipment is inconvenient to clear up the material sediment moreover.

Detailed Description
As shown in fig. 1-4, a base oil production filter equipment, including barrel 1, barrel 1 lower extreme is fixed with the exit tube 25 rather than the intercommunication, and barrel 1 internal fixation has inner panel 2, and inner panel 2 upper end is fixed with rather than endocentric fixed disk 4, has seted up a plurality of arcs on the inner panel 2 in the fixed disk 4 outside, a plurality of arcs set up according to the axle center circumference equipartition of inner panel 2, and the arc internal fixation has lower filter screen 3, and fixed disk 4 upper end rotates and is provided with rather than endocentric carousel 5, and inner panel 2 lower extreme is fixed with the power device who is used for driving carousel 5, power device is including fixing motor 6 at inner panel 2 lower extreme, and the output shaft of motor 6 runs through inner panel 2 and fixed disk 4 after with carousel 5 fixed connection, inner panel 2 lower extreme is fixed with oil shield 7, and motor 6 is located oil shield 7.
The left end and the right end of the rotary table 5 are both fixed with transverse supporting rods 8, the lower end of each supporting rod 8 is fixed with bristles 9 in the region corresponding to the arc-shaped groove, the lower ends of the bristles 9 are in contact with the upper end of the lower filter screen 3, the supporting rods 8 are fixedly connected with the fixed cylinder 11 through supporting rods 10, the upper end of the rotary table 5 is fixed with the fixed cylinder 11, a filter cylinder 12 is installed in the fixed cylinder 11, the outer edge of the filter cylinder 12 is in contact with the inner edge of the fixed cylinder 11, the upper end of the filter cylinder 12 is internally fixed with a pull rod 26, the cylinder wall of the filter cylinder 12 is provided with a plurality of openings, the inside of each opening is fixed with an upper filter screen 16, the cylinder wall of the fixed cylinder 11 is provided with a slotted hole 13 corresponding to each opening, the lower hole wall of each opening is flush with the upper end of the bottom plate of the filter cylinder 12, the lower hole wall of each slotted hole 13 is flush with the lower part of each opening, the upper end of the fixed cylinder 11 is provided with a plurality of grooves 14, the fixed rods 15 corresponding to the grooves 14, the upper end of the cylinder body 1 is provided with an upper hole 17 concentric with the cylinder body, the diameter of the upper hole 17 is larger than that of the filter cylinder 12, the upper end of the cylinder body 1 is detachably, fixedly and hermetically connected with a cover plate 18, the lower end of the cover plate 18 is fixedly provided with a plurality of vertical inserting rods 24, the upper end of the cylinder body 1 is provided with a blind hole 23 corresponding to the inserting rods 24, the inserting rods 24 are inserted into the blind holes 23, the lower end of the cover plate 18 is rotatably connected with a rotating sleeve 19, the upper end of the filter cylinder 12 is inserted into the rotating sleeve 19, a press ring 20 is fixed in the rotating sleeve 19 above the filter cylinder 12, the upper end of the filter cylinder 12 is fixedly provided with a seal ring 21, the upper end of the filter cylinder 12 is in sealing contact with the press ring 20 through the seal ring 21, the cover plate 18 is fixedly provided with an inlet pipe 22, and the inlet pipe 22 penetrates through the cover plate 18 and is communicated with the filter cylinder 12.
The utility model discloses during the use, treat filterable base oil and enter into in straining a section of thick bamboo 12 through advancing pipe 22, the base oil that enters into in straining a section of thick bamboo 12 flows to inner panel 2 after through last filter screen 16 and slotted hole 13 on, then discharge to barrel 1 lower extreme after filtering through lower filter screen 3 on inner panel 2 and discharge through exit tube 25, it can hold back the filter residue in straining a section of thick bamboo 12 to go up filter screen 16, lower filter screen 3 in the arc wall can carry out further filtration to the base oil, when the filter residue in a section of thick bamboo 12 is strained in needs clearance, starter motor 6, make carousel 5, solid fixed cylinder 11, strain a section of thick bamboo 12 and rotate the in-process, under the mating reaction of recess 14 and dead lever 15, can prevent solid fixed cylinder 11 and strain a section of thick bamboo 12 and rotate relatively, strain a section of thick bamboo 12 rotatory in-process, under the effect of centrifugal force, base oil in the filter residue can be thrown away, the rotatory in-process of carousel 5, branch 8, The support rods 10 and the brush bristles 9 rotate along with the support rods 10, the brush bristles 9 can brush off a small part of filter residues at the upper end of the lower filter screen 3, so that the lower filter screen 3 is kept smooth, then the cover plate 18 is disassembled, after the cover plate 18 is disassembled, the filter cartridge 12 is pulled out of the fixed cylinder 11 through the pull rod 26, and then the filter residues in the filter cartridge 12 are poured and then are subjected to centralized treatment.
